R is an open source statistical programming and visualization language.
R provides a rich environment for data processing, visualization and analysis. Along with the R XML package for reading XML (VIVO RDF Schema is a flavor of XML) and statnet, a library for network visualization and analysis, a strong environment for development of VIVO applications can be assembled.
Mike Conlon is working on using R for VIVO to develop tools for extracting, reporting and visualizing R data. See RDF Graph Visualize Report.
You can download R for Windows, Linux or Mac from http://www.r-project.org. Once R is installed, you can execute the R commands below to install the XML package and the statnet package.
